ITEM SUMMARY: 

                     McKinney Arts Commission funds local arts organizations through Season Support Grants.

                     13 arts agencies have MAC Season Support Grants.

                     MAC Liaisons would offer the ability for Commissioners to learn more about local arts organizations.

                     Each arts organization would have one MAC liaison.

                     Commissioners would be assigned at least one arts organization. 5 commissioners would be assigned two arts organizations.

 

BACKGROUND INFORMATION: 

                     McKinney Arts Commission liaisons were part of the commissioners’ function when the commission was established in 2005.

                     The liaison role was discontinued in 2011.

                     As part of City Ordinance - Sec. 2-199. - Duties and responsibilities.                     

                     The arts commission shall discharge the following responsibilities:

o                     (1)Develop cooperation and coordination with private citizens, institutions, agencies and local, regional and national art organizations interested in conducting activities related to the arts.

o                     (2)Provide and assist in the development of the arts in the city by providing a biannual "state of the arts" assessment to the city council.

o                     (3)Make recommendations to the city council relative to expenditures of budgeted and allocated city funds for the purpose of promoting and sustaining the arts in the city.

o                     (4)Advise and assist the city council in connection with proposed arts related programs within the community.

o                     (5)Provides oversight of the development and management of the public art master plan.

o                     (6)Responsible for fundraising efforts toward the funding of public art. (Ord. No. 2013-10-093, § 2, 10-1-2013)
